At Factor e Farm, we found this magnetic drill to provide super performance at low cost, including chuck interchangeability (regular chuck included) between regular bits and annular cutters.
Look up the Blue Rock Magnetic Drill, BRM 35, on Ebay. We liked this so much that we bought 5 total as of Nov 2012, and are very satisfied with this item. $385 with shipping to USA. One drill appears to have a loud noise in gear box, but that's possibly from being dropped. Appears gears have work, need replacement gear set.
